J.G van der Wath Secondary exists under misconceptions based on the past. The school was established in 1921 and reined through the era of apartheid. It was only accessible to the then advantaged group of society and therefore boasted with tremendous support from parents and the administration for education. Currently the trend has changed and a total of 598 are enrolled of whom 99% hail from the
previously disadvantaged community. Our class groups range between 40-45 learners per class. We boast with annual best results in grades 11 and 12 who write external national examinations. Our school has been crowned among the best schools in the country as the results clearly show. We have a small team of staff consisting of young and old of whom the young is in the majority. Our learners take part in a variety of after school programs and activities among others sport- soccer, netball, volleyball, basketball and rugby. We have social and educational clubs such as the TADA, Peer educators, the very successful school choirl, Chess club, Environmental club as well as the Maths and Science clubs.
